Harvest Festival
Schedule
Sat, 13 Sep, 2025 at 12:00 pm
UTC-05:00Location
1800 W 12th St, Davenport, IA 52804, United States | Davenport, IA
Where is it happening?
1800 W 12th St, Davenport, IA 52804, United StatesEvent Location & Nearby Stays: